Full Stack Developer

Full Stack Developer

Job Description:
Arrow Electronics, Inc. - a Fortune 150 company with global headquarters in Denver - helps the world's best technology companies think "Five Years Out," working together to continually innovate the "next big thing". We are a global provider of technology products, services and solutions, with 2016 sales of $23.83 billion. We are currently migrating our commerce stack to SAP Hybris, building UI using latest frameworks such as AngularJS. Lot of Run & Transform initiatives in progress. Exciting time to join Arrow Digital team and make a difference!
As a member of the Arrow.com Digital team, our newest Full Stack Developer team member will be passionate about developing solutions to achieve business needs and will be involved in all aspects of the software development lifecycle including technical design, implementation, testing, deployment and support of cutting-edge applications.
•Provide value by integrating business rules and content in accordance with requirements
•Work closely with Product Owners, Analysts and QA in an Agile environment to ensure quality, security and maintenance of applications, and to ensure code meets development standards and guidelines.
•Contribute to a DevOps culture and development of continuous integrations processes and tools.
•Mentor Junior developers on technical approaches and best practices
•Develop, document, and advocate SOLID software architecture practices
•Ability to jump between frontend and backend work
•Challenge established norms and innovate
•Contribute to the success of your team and company
•Make a difference


•A passion for accomplishing great things by creating fast, maintainable, and valuable applications
•6+ years of .NET or Java and relational database development experience
•3+ years' experience developing rich internet applications using HTML5/CSS3/JavaScript
•Familiarity with at least one MV* JavaScript framework (Angular.js, Backbone.js, Ember.js)
•Strong analytical and problem-solving skills
•Strong verbal and written communication skills; ability to work effectively with various organizations in pursuit of problem solutions
•Experience using Agile methodologies and tools such as Scrum and JIRA
•Strong understanding of Object Oriented Programming (OOP) concepts and enterprise design patterns
•Experience providing REST/SOAP APIs for user interface consumption
•Comfort with and understanding of version control, continuous integration, and deployment tools
•Software architecture experience in an enterprise size environment
•Strong understanding of Unit Testing
•Self-starter who can work independently


•Experience with enterprise OO design patterns such as the Repository pattern
•3+ years' experience working within an Agile development methodology Scrum
•Ability to prove prior experience integrating multiple data sources/systems for consumption by rich websites
•Hands on experience utilizing and customizing a CMS-driven website (Sitecore)
•Bachelor's Degree in Computer Science, MIS, Math, Engineering or equivalent

Denver (Panorama)

Time Type:
Full time

Meet Some of Arrow Electronics's Employees

Will P.

Applications Engineer

Will leads the technological enhancements to Arrow’s Sam Car Project. He oversees and contributes to development of its microcontrollers, firmware, and MEMS sensors.

Jaqueline M.

Global Cloud Business Analyst

Jaqueline specializes in cloud business operations by helping new clients onboard and connect with Arrow’s marketplace, implement solutions, and understand best practices to optimize outcomes.

Back to top